Our consulting client is seeking a full-time Project Manager
- Water for their offices in Chicago, IL. This role is a hybrid role requiring some in office time as well as remote work. This role is an exciting role where you are managing client projects and also developing new business in Illinois.
Manage all aspects of water and wastewater Engineering Procurement Construction (EPC) projects in the Chicago metro area. Responsible for the execution of contracted engineering, procurement, and construction scope in the areas of performance, financial metrics, planning, schedule, quality, contractual compliance, safety, and client satisfaction. Provide for the successful staffing of projects and lead teams of multi-disciplined professionals. Coordinate and integrate the activities associated with the engineering, procurement, construction, and startup elements of the project team, including the activities of third parties.
Manages multiple, client-facing water and wastewater projects. Obtains new/repeat business; supports contract negotiations.
Minimum Qualifications Bachelors degree in Engineering (Civil or Environmental) with > 8 years of related experience working with municipal water/ww utilities. PE license or ability to obtain within 6 months. Has a network of industry connections in the IL area.
